A “Jetsons”-style “air taxi” may be transporting New Yorkers before the end of the decade, its manufacturer says. The UK-based tech company Vertical Aerospace touted its futuristic Valo aircraft, a four-seat electric vehicle designed to fly up to 100 miles at 150 mph, at an industry preview in Manhattan last week — calling the contraption a first because of its zero-emissions power source. “If you think of mass transport … the infrastructure just doesn’t work anymore,” company CEO Stuart Simpson told The Post in unveiling the craft, which has a pilot and is roughly the same size as a chopper...

Minnesota Attorney General Keith Ellison previously argued that Americans have no Second Amendment right to carry firearms at political protests. Ellison joined 16 other attorneys general from Democrat-led states in an amicus brief filed with the Ninth Circuit Court of Appeals in January 2024, according to court records. The coalition argued states can ban firearms at political rallies and protests because such events attract violence. The group also contended that guns at demonstrations could intimidate people and discourage them from speaking freely. Andy Burnham may be merely “disappointed” at being barred from standing as an MP, but voters on the streets of Greater Manchester are infuriated. Constituents of Gorton and Denton have told of their anger at the rearguard tactics employed by Sir Keir Starmer’s allies to rebuff their “King of the North”. Some said they were now considering voting for Reform UK in the looming by-election. A panel of the Labour Party’s National Executive Committee (NEC) blocked Mr Burnham’s attempt to return to Westminster by eight votes to one on Sunday. The daughter of one of Iran’s most powerful officials was quietly ousted from her position at Emory University following a wave of public outrage over her employment, The California Post confirmed. Fatemeh Ardeshir-Larijani, an assistant professor at Emory’s prestigious Winship Cancer Institute, is no longer employed by the prestigious Atlanta-based school, a university spokesperson said Sunday.
